4. Inserting batteries does not turn the device on. In Spot Check Activation Mode, the device
turns on when a finger is inserted in the sensor.
NOTE: When batteries are removed in low battery mode, the device maintains the time
and date for up to 30 seconds. After battery replacement, check the device's screen
during startup to ensure date and time are set. If the battery level is at or below the critical
level, clock settings are lost and if in Programmed Activation Mode, the device reverts to
Spot Check Activation Mode. Use nVISION software to synchronize the clock and confirm
the device is in the desired activation mode (see "Accessing nVISION Settings" on page
34).

Wristband Description

There are two wristbands available for the use with the WristOx2, Model 3150 - a multiple use
wristband and a single use disposable wristband.
The multiple use wristband has a long segment, a short segment, and a plastic ring (figure 6).
The wristband uses hook and loop fasteners to secure the wristband to the device and to the
patient.
The long segment has two fasteners to accommodate a wide range of wrist sizes.
Figures 7 and 8 demonstrate how to attach the multiple use wristband to the device. Figure 9
shows front and back views of the attached wristband.
